System for driving a nematic liquid crystal

  • US 6,424,329 B1
  • Filed: 09/12/2000
  • Issued: 07/23/2002
  • Est. Priority Date: 08/06/1996
  • Status: Expired due to Term

1. A system for driving a nematic liquid crystal in a liquid crystal display device in which the nematic liquid crystal is confined between a common electrode and a segment electrode that are placed between two polarizing plates, comprising:

  • means for applying to said liquid crystal a voltage of a value corresponding to image data to be displayed;

    means for applying a constant voltage to said liquid crystal;

    means for switching application of said constant voltage and application of said voltage corresponding to image data to be displayed in a predetermined cycle;

    ratio of length of time for which said constant voltage is applied relative to length of time for which said voltage corresponding to image data to be displayed being constant; and

    one of said constant voltage and said voltage corresponding to image data to be displayed being applied to said liquid crystal after said voltages are switched, said nematic liquid crystal having electro-optical characteristics that exhibit a transmittance determined by one of the voltages without maintaining any prior hysteresis when said voltages are switched from one to the other.
